The details here are taken from an old postcard. They cover World War 1 and the men whoserved from the Conservative Club in Carrhill Road, Mossely, part of the Yorkshire Ward. The translation of names and initials may not be 100% correct here as they were taken from the card but the majority appear to be correct. Those who died have been marked here with a poppy but on the Roll of Honour are boxed in.

BENNETT Joseph

Private 208629, 6th Battalion, Dorsetshire Regiment. Died of wounds 27 August 1918 in France & Flanders. Aged 31. Born and resident Mossley, enlisted Milnsbridge, Yorkshire. Husband of Charlotte Bennett, of Mountain View, Cavehill Rd., Mossley, Manchester. Formerly 2142, West Riding Regiment - he is listed as this on Roll of Honour). Buried in BULLS ROAD CEMETERY, FLERS, Somme, France. Plot II. Row A. Grave 16.

BATES Stanley
Private 4952, 1st/5th Battalion, Cheshire Regiment. Died 9 November 1916 in France & Flanders. Aged 23. Born Mossley, enlisted Ashton-Under-Lyne. Son of Albert and Mary Jane Bates, of Mossley; husband of Florrie Bates, of 39, Andrew St., Mossley, Manchester. Buried in ST. SEVER CEMETERY EXTENSION, ROUEN, Seine-Maritime, France. Plot O. Section I. Row K. Grave 3.

GARTSIDE William
Gunner W/5857, "A" Battery, 105th Brigade, Royal Field Artillery. Killed in action 19 September 1917 in France & Flanders. Aged 27. Enlisted Ashton-Under-Lyne, resident Mossley. Son of Harold and Martha Ann Gartside, of 51, Carr Hill Rd., Mossley, Manchester. Buried in THE HUTS CEMETERY, Ieper, West-Vlaanderen, Belgium. Plot VI. Row D. Grave 13.

HOWARD Albert
Private 1951, 1st/7th Battalion, Duke of Wellington's (West Riding Regiment). Died of wounds 24 November 1915 in France & Flanders. Aged 32. Born and enlisted Mossley. Husband of Alice Howard, of 7, Rodney St., Mossley, nr. Manchester. Buried in HOSPITAL FARM CEMETERY, Ieper, West-Vlaanderen, Belgium. Row D. Grave 12.

THWAITE Frank
Private 31838, 2nd Battalion, Duke of Wellington's (West Riding Regiment). Killed in action 9 March 1918. Born Long Preston, Yorkshire, enlisted Settle, Yorkshire. Buried in VIEILLE-CHAPELLE NEW MILITARY CEMETERY, LACOUTURE, Pas de Calais, France. Plot IX. Row C. Grave 6.

WADSWORTH Percy
Sergeant 60407, 14th Battalion, Leicestershire Regiment. Died of wounds 26 August 1918 in France & Flanders. Aged 34. Born and enlisted Mossley. Husband of Mary A. Wadsworth, of 53, Stamford Rd., Mossley, Manchester. Formerly 23151, Manchester Regiment. Buried in SAILLY-LABOURSE COMMUNAL CEMETERY EXTENSION, Pas de Calais, France. Row J. Grave 1.
